|
Autor |
Nachricht |
T.o.M.
|
Titel: hab leider Probleme... (open_basedir restriction)
Verfasst am: So, 18 Dez 2005, 18:25 |
|
|
Hallo,
Erstmal Danke für den Super-Mod! Ist genau das was ich gesucht hab!
Eine Frage vorweg bevor ich zu dem Problem komme:
Ich habe Version 1.0 installiert, kann ich trotzdem einfach das Installations-Script der der 1.20 ausführen oder gibt es dann Probleme mit den veränderten Dateien?
(hab die V1.0 schon vor ner Weile runtergalden, aber heute erst eingebaut)
So, jetzt zu meinem Problem:
Ich habe Version 1.0 installiert (erst auf meinen Funpic Account, wo es Einwandfrei funktioniert und anschließend in meinem eigentlichen Forum) und bekomme folgende Fehlermeldungen wenn ich ein Bild hochgeladen habe:
Warning: getimagesize(): open_basedir restriction in effect. File(/tmp/phpgeyn2U) is not within the allowed path(s): (/var/kunden/webs/lutterbues/) in /var/kunden/webs/lutterbues/forum/uploadpic.php on line 125
Warning: getimagesize(/tmp/phpgeyn2U): failed to open stream: Operation not permitted in /var/kunden/webs/lutterbues/forum/uploadpic.php on line 125
Warning: copy(): open_basedir restriction in effect. File(/tmp/phpgeyn2U) is not within the allowed path(s): (/var/kunden/webs/lutterbues/) in /var/kunden/webs/lutterbues/forum/uploadpic.php on line 169
Warning: chmod(): Unable to access /var/kunden/webs/lutterbues//forum/userpix/2_20051213_113812_1.jpg in /var/kunden/webs/lutterbues/forum/uploadpic.php on line 175
Warning: chmod(): No such file or directory in /var/kunden/webs/lutterbues/forum/uploadpic.php on line 175
Warning: filesize(): Stat failed for /var/kunden/webs/lutterbues//forum/userpix/2_20051213_113812_1.jpg (errno=2 - No such file or directory) in /var/kunden/webs/lutterbues/forum/uploadpic.php on line 178
Warning: unlink(): open_basedir restriction in effect. File(/tmp/phpgeyn2U) is not within the allowed path(s): (/var/kunden/webs/lutterbues/) in /var/kunden/webs/lutterbues/forum/uploadpic.php on line 184
Warning: Cannot modify header information - headers already sent by (output started at /var/kunden/webs/lutterbues/forum/uploadpic.php:125) in /var/kunden/webs/lutterbues/forum/includes/page_header.php on line 475
Warning: Cannot modify header information - headers already sent by (output started at /var/kunden/webs/lutterbues/forum/uploadpic.php:125) in /var/kunden/webs/lutterbues/forum/includes/page_header.php on line 477
Warning: Cannot modify header information - headers already sent by (output started at /var/kunden/webs/lutterbues/forum/uploadpic.php:125) in /var/kunden/webs/lutterbues/forum/includes/page_header.php on line 478
Woran könnte das liegen?
|
|
Nach oben |
|
boris
Beiträge: 11196
|
Titel: Re: hab leider Probleme...
Verfasst am: So, 18 Dez 2005, 20:49 |
|
|
T.o.M. @ So, 18 Dez 2005, 17:25 gab folgendes von sich: |
Ich habe Version 1.0 installiert, kann ich trotzdem einfach das Installations-Script der der 1.20 ausführen oder gibt es dann Probleme mit den veränderten Dateien? |
Kuck mal in den Ordner "update" (und "translations/german/update") - die Dateien mußt du der Reihe nach durchführen, sonst hast du nur die Datenbankeinträge für v1.2.0, die dir aber ohne die Programmierung (bzw. mit den Daten von v1.0.0) nichts nützen.
T.o.M. gab folgendes von sich: |
erst auf meinen Funpic Account, wo es Einwandfrei funktioniert und anschließend in meinem eigentlichen Forum) und bekomme folgende Fehlermeldungen wenn ich ein Bild hochgeladen habe: |
Anscheinend stimmen die Pfadangaben von deinem Funpic-Account und deinem "eigentlichen Forum" nicht überein - ich würde empfehlen, auf dem "eigentlichen Forum" die Version v1.2.0 komplett zu installieren.
____________ beehave - home of humbug ... [we can't afford to be neutral]
|
|
Nach oben |
|
T.o.M.
|
Titel: (Kein Titel)
Verfasst am: Mo, 19 Dez 2005, 00:35 |
|
|
Welche Pfadangaben meinst du? War mir eigentlich klar das die Pfadangaben nicht gleich sind und ich hab sie dementsprechend geändert.
Bin mit dem Forum damals umgezogen von funpic.de auf meinen "eigenen" Webspace.
|
|
Nach oben |
|
boris
Beiträge: 11196
|
Titel: (Kein Titel)
Verfasst am: Mo, 19 Dez 2005, 10:35 |
|
|
T.o.M. @ So, 18 Dez 2005, 23:35 gab folgendes von sich: |
Welche Pfadangaben meinst du? |
Die zum Bildverzeichnis z.B., dann aber auch die phpbb_root_path und die script_path in der Config von phpBB.
Aber wie gesagt: installier dir die Version 1.2.0 - es wäre müßig, nach Fehlern in einer alten Version zu suchen, die wahrscheinlich in der neuen schon lange behoben sind !
____________ beehave - home of humbug ... [we can't afford to be neutral]
|
|
Nach oben |
|
T.o.M.
|
Titel: (Kein Titel)
Verfasst am: Di, 20 Dez 2005, 09:27 |
|
|
Jup, werd ich machen, am WE hab ich Zeit dafür.
|
|
Nach oben |
|
T.o.M.
|
Titel: (Kein Titel)
Verfasst am: Mo, 26 Dez 2005, 15:04 |
|
|
Hi Boris,
habe heute das Update auf 1.22 durchgeführt.
Habe meinem User die Berechtigung gegeben, aber finde beim Posting nun keine Option zum Bilder hochladen.
Die Updates für die deutsche Sprache habe ich angepasst, nur hiermit habe ich ein Problem:
Code: |
#-----[ OPEN ]------------------------------------------
#
# NOTE: the following action fixes a bug that *only* occured if you installed an
# early release of UploadPic's version 1.1.2 with EasyMOD
# (so most likely you won't find the following "FIND"-bit, just ignore the
# replace-statement in that case)
#
admin/admin_users.php
#
#-----[ FIND ]------------------------------------------
#
user_rank = $user_rank" . $avatar_sql . "
user_allow_uploadpic = $user_allowuploadpic,
#
#-----[ REPLACE WITH ]------------------------------------------
#
user_rank = $user_rank" . $avatar_sql . ", user_allow_uploadpic = $user_allowuploadpic
|
Ich benutze das SubBlack-Theme, das einzige was ich in der datei finden konnte sah so aus:
Code: |
$user_status = ( !empty($HTTP_POST_VARS['user_status']) ) ? intval( $HTTP_POST_VARS['user_status'] ) : 0;
$user_allowuploadpic = ( !empty($HTTP_POST_VARS['user_allowuploadpic']) ) ? intval( $HTTP_POST_VARS['user_allowuploadpic'] ) : 0;
$user_allowpm = ( !empty($HTTP_POST_VARS['user_allowpm']) ) ? intval( $HTTP_POST_VARS['user_allowpm'] ) : 0;
$user_rank = ( !empty($HTTP_POST_VARS['user_rank']) ) ? intval( $HTTP_POST_VARS['user_rank'] ) : 0;
$user_allowavatar = ( !empty($HTTP_POST_VARS['user_allowavatar']) ) ? intval( $HTTP_POST_VARS['user_allowavatar'] ) : 0;
|
Könnte das daran liegen?
|
|
Nach oben |
|
boris
Beiträge: 11196
|
Titel: (Kein Titel)
Verfasst am: Mo, 26 Dez 2005, 16:48 |
|
|
T.o.M. gab folgendes von sich: |
Ich benutze das SubBlack-Theme, das einzige was ich in der datei finden konnte sah so aus: |
Welches Template du benutzt, ist vollkommen egal - die Template-Dateien sind die *.tpl-Dateien, die PHP-Dateien sind in jedem Forum gleich !
T.o.M. gab folgendes von sich: |
Könnte das daran liegen? |
Nein, lies mal den von dir selbst zitierten Hinweis zu dem Punkt:
Zitat: |
NOTE: the following action fixes a bug that *only* occured if you installed an early release of UploadPic's version 1.1.2 with EasyMOD (so most likely you won't find the following "FIND"-bit, just ignore the replace-statement in that case) |
Jetzt klar ?
____________ beehave - home of humbug ... [we can't afford to be neutral]
|
|
Nach oben |
|
T.o.M.
|
Titel: (Kein Titel)
Verfasst am: Mo, 26 Dez 2005, 17:34 |
|
|
jau, das hatte ich schon verstanden, dachte aber das es sich dabei "nur" auf das SubSilver-Theme bezieht und es beim SubBlack evtl anders ist.
Ah, hab den Fehler gefunden.
Aber beim hochladen kommt immernoch das gleiche wie bei der 1.0.0
Code: |
Warning: getimagesize(): open_basedir restriction in effect. File(/tmp/phpXPmXx6) is not within the allowed path(s): (/var/kunden/webs/lutterbues/) in /var/kunden/webs/lutterbues/forum/uploadpic.php on line 119
Warning: getimagesize(/tmp/phpXPmXx6): failed to open stream: Operation not permitted in /var/kunden/webs/lutterbues/forum/uploadpic.php on line 119
Warning: Cannot modify header information - headers already sent by (output started at /var/kunden/webs/lutterbues/forum/uploadpic.php:119) in /var/kunden/webs/lutterbues/forum/includes/page_header.php on line 475
Warning: Cannot modify header information - headers already sent by (output started at /var/kunden/webs/lutterbues/forum/uploadpic.php:119) in /var/kunden/webs/lutterbues/forum/includes/page_header.php on line 477
Warning: Cannot modify header information - headers already sent by (output started at /var/kunden/webs/lutterbues/forum/uploadpic.php:119) in /var/kunden/webs/lutterbues/forum/includes/page_header.php on line 478
|
und darunter steht dann:
Code: |
Allgemeiner Fehler
Bild konnte nicht erzeugt werden.
Versuche, ein kleineres Bild hochzuladen.
DEBUG MODE
Line : 122
File : uploadpic.php
|
Dabei war das Bild ein Avatar, sollte also nicht zu groß gewesen sein.
|
|
Nach oben |
|
boris
Beiträge: 11196
|
Titel: (Kein Titel)
Verfasst am: Mo, 26 Dez 2005, 21:57 |
|
|
T.o.M. @ Mo, 26 Dez 2005, 16:34 gab folgendes von sich: |
Aber beim hochladen kommt immernoch das gleiche wie bei der 1.0.0 |
- wie ist der Pfad zu Forum ?
- welcher Wert steht in der Variable "script_path" ? (Tabelle phpbb_config in der Datenbank)
- welcher Wert steht in der Variable "uploadpic_picdir" ?
- leg mal deine uploadpic.php als Textdatei irgendwo auf deinen Webspace
____________ beehave - home of humbug ... [we can't afford to be neutral]
|
|
Nach oben |
|
T.o.M.
|
Titel: (Kein Titel)
Verfasst am: Di, 27 Dez 2005, 00:25 |
|
|
der Pfad zu Forum ist: "lutterbuese-online.de/forum/"
Wo find ich in der Tabelle "script_path" und "uploadpic_picdir"?
Im Adminbereich vom Forum steht bei Scriptpfad "/forum/"
und in der UploadPic config steht bei Bilderverzeichnis (ab Domain-"root"): "/forum/userpix/"
Meine uploadpic.php findest du hier.
|
|
Nach oben |
|
boris
Beiträge: 11196
|
Titel: (Kein Titel)
Verfasst am: Di, 27 Dez 2005, 01:49 |
|
|
T.o.M. @ Mo, 26 Dez 2005, 23:25 gab folgendes von sich: |
Wo find ich in der Tabelle "script_path" und "uploadpic_picdir"? |
In der Tabelle phpbb_config steht links in der Spalte "config_name" der Variablenname (z.B. "script_path") und rechts in der Spalte "config_value" der Wert ... aber über die Admin gehts auch ...
Deine Pfadeinträge sind eigentlich so, wie sie sein sollten ... es sieht allerdings so aus, als ob das hier völlig unwichtig ist und auf deinem Server irgendwelche Restriktionen eingeschaltet wurden, denn der Fehler tritt ja garnicht beim Upload auf, sondern erst bei dem Versuch, die Datei- bzw. Bildgröße festzustellen - und da darf das Skript plötzlich nicht auf das temporäre PHP-Verzeichnis zugreifen:
Zitat: |
Warning: getimagesize(): open_basedir restriction in effect. |
Du müßtest also mit dem Administrator des Servers klären, ob da irgendetwas eingeschaltet ist, was den Zugriff verhindert, da kann ich auf der Skriptseite garnichts dran machen.
____________ beehave - home of humbug ... [we can't afford to be neutral]
|
|
Nach oben |
|
T.o.M.
|
Titel: (Kein Titel)
Verfasst am: Di, 27 Dez 2005, 08:39 |
|
|
OK, dann werde ich das mal tun.
Herzlichen Dank für die Mühe!
|
|
Nach oben |
|
boris
Beiträge: 11196
|
Titel: (Kein Titel)
Verfasst am: Di, 27 Dez 2005, 12:21 |
|
|
Was die Meldung "Bild konnte nicht erzeugt werden. Versuche, ein kleineres Bild hochzuladen." auch noch erzeugen kann (wie ich gerade in einem anderen Forum gemerkt habe), ist eine zu hohe Einstellung der erlaubten Bildabmessungen ... in dem Fall war 1500x1500 eingestellt, was zu groß für die in diesem Fall serverseitig erlaubte Speichergröße war.
____________ beehave - home of humbug ... [we can't afford to be neutral]
|
|
Nach oben |
|
T.o.M.
|
Titel: (Kein Titel)
Verfasst am: Di, 27 Dez 2005, 15:16 |
|
|
Ich hatte die Standarteinstellungen gelassen, sollte aber eigentlich keine Probleme mit der Dateigröße geben, ich hab noch 4images als Bildergalerie am laufen.
|
|
Nach oben |
|
asuloeman
|
Titel: (Kein Titel)
Verfasst am: Do, 29 Dez 2005, 17:58 |
|
|
Hallo...
bei mir hat alles geklappt...
aber....
wie kann ich nicht verwendete Bilder löschen...??
gibt es ein button oder wo ist die funktion zu finden?
|
|
Nach oben |
|
boris
Beiträge: 11196
|
Titel: (Kein Titel)
Verfasst am: Do, 29 Dez 2005, 18:09 |
|
|
asuloeman @ Do, 29 Dez 2005, 16:58 gab folgendes von sich: |
wie kann ich nicht verwendete Bilder löschen...?? |
In der Admin links auf UploadPic klicken und dann den Link "Alle unbenutzten Bilder löschen" anklicken ?!?
Oder auf einen Usernamen klicken und die Bilder einzeln löschen ...
____________ beehave - home of humbug ... [we can't afford to be neutral]
|
|
Nach oben |
|
asuloeman
|
Titel: (Kein Titel)
Verfasst am: Do, 29 Dez 2005, 18:12 |
|
|
vielen dank...
habe ich auch gerade gefunden...
|
|
Nach oben |
|
T.o.M.
|
Titel: (Kein Titel)
Verfasst am: Mi, 08 Feb 2006, 14:50 |
|
|
Hallo Boris,
mein Problem war das beim Server "php_safe_mode" eingeschaltet war und deswegen auch der Upload von Avataren nicht funktioniert.
UploadPic funktioniert jetzt soweit (V1.22), nur können einige anscheinend keine jpg´s hochladen, mit gif´s funktionierts.
Ich werde die Tage mal die aktuellste Version aufspielen und schauen ob das Problem dann immernoch besteht.
Oder gibts irgend eine einstellung das es bei einigen halt nicht mit jedem Dateiformat funktioniert?
|
|
Nach oben |
|
boris
Beiträge: 11196
|
Titel: (Kein Titel)
Verfasst am: Mi, 08 Feb 2006, 14:56 |
|
|
T.o.M. @ Mi, 08 Feb 2006, 13:50 gab folgendes von sich: |
Oder gibts irgend eine einstellung das es bei einigen halt nicht mit jedem Dateiformat funktioniert? |
Nein, die einzige Beschränkung liegt bei der Laufzeit für das Skript (Servereinstellung), die überschritten werden kann, wenn die Bilddatei riesig ist - mit dem Bildformat hat das aber nichts zu tun.
Aber was heißt "anscheinend keine jpgs hochladen" ?? Gibts ne Fehlermeldung ?
____________ beehave - home of humbug ... [we can't afford to be neutral]
|
|
Nach oben |
|
T.o.M.
|
Titel: (Kein Titel)
Verfasst am: Mi, 08 Feb 2006, 18:31 |
|
|
ja, gibt es:
Zitat: |
Allgemeiner Fehler
Bild konnte nicht erzeugt werden.
Versuche, ein kleineres Bild hochzuladen.
DEBUG MODE
Line : 122
File : uploadpic.php
|
(das Bild war 640x480 70 kb jpg )
edit:
lustig, von zuhause aus gehts mitm FireFox, mit IE ned...
versteh ich nu echt nich...
|
|
Nach oben |
|
|
|
ähnliche Beiträge |
|
Thema
| Autor
| Forum
| Antworten
| Verfasst am
|
|
Michael Bishop - Dieser Mann ist leider tot |
boris |
kühnes mittelscharfer |
0 |
Mo, 12 Jun 2023, 19:22 |
|
Heutige Probleme im 50er Jahre-Stil |
jrose |
internet junk |
0 |
Mi, 10 Dez 2014, 23:09 |
|
Probleme bei Bildauswahl bei Firefox |
franklin84 |
mod support |
1 |
Mo, 05 Jan 2009, 21:20 |
|
Pfad-Probleme mit UploadPic |
KissNews |
mod support |
5 |
So, 13 Apr 2008, 11:28 |
|
Autologin- / Cookie-Probleme |
boris |
werkstatt |
1 |
So, 06 Apr 2008, 22:49 |
Schreiben: nein. Antworten: nein. Bearbeiten: nein. Löschen: nein. Umfragen: nein.
|